Countries that grant the most parental leave to fathers

A child needs equal time from both of its parents but, some working parents are unable to spend as much time with their kids as they should. If we talk about fathers specifically, despite all the love and spoiling, they, unfortunately, spend lesser time with their kids.

As the infographic shows, US fathers get no parental leave at all. The country was among the ones that lack paid maternity leave for new moms but, fathers are also kept from getting a day off from their work to spend some quality time with their kids at home.

In various developed countries, new fathers are seen to take leave for weeks or even leave the job in order to give all of their time to their just-born child. Japan seems to be a pretty considerate country in terms of parental leave since new fathers there are allowed 30 weeks of leave that too, paid.
South Korea on the other hand allows 17 weeks of paid parental leave to the father only and ranks as the second whereas, Sweden rounds of the third position with an allowance of 10 weeks’ parental leave for dads.

Even though Japan and South Korea offer an extremely generous parental leave to the fathers, very few of them avail this opportunity since they fear complications in their careers.

The United Kingdom, Australia, and Canada accompany the United States with no parental leaves for the new dads while their baby is just born.
